The announcement for the nominations of the 2026 Spirit Awards has begun.
This annual awards event celebrates exceptional accomplishments in film and television. To qualify, films must have budgets under $30 million, and those competing for the John Cassavetes Award have a maximum budget of $1 million. In the television categories, eligibility is restricted to new shows that have completed one season, released between October 1, 2024, and September 30, 2025. Anthology series are only eligible during their inaugural season.
The 40th Film Independent Spirit Awards is set to occur on February 15, 2026, taking place at the Hollywood Palladium.
